Fifteen people, including three children, were rescued from drowning in Yamuna river near Shamshan Ghat in north Delhi's Burari, police said today.
Yesterday, the police were informed that about 15 members of a family were about to drown in the river and required emergency help, a police officer said.
Eight men, four women and three children were trapped in the water and were unable to come out, the officer said.
The police with the help of locals, the NDRF and the Delhi Fire Service managed to rescue them.
A senior officer from Delhi Fire Service said two fire tenders were rushed to the spot for the rescue operation.
The police said it took them nearly an hour to rescue the victims. Despite repeated warnings, villagers were still venturing into their agricultural fields on the banks of Yamuna, they said.
The victims were agricultural labourers based in Ghadi village in Burari, they added.
